State Council Issues Opinion as H1 Service Sector Value Added Rises 5.2% to 41.4 Trillion Yuan
China's service sector value added reached 41.4 trillion yuan in the first half of 2025, up 5.2% year-on-year, outpacing overall GDP growth by 0.5 percentage points. The sector accounted for 59.5% of GDP, up 0.3 percentage points from a year earlier, and contributed 66.1% to economic growth. Sub-sectors including information technology, leasing and business services grew strongly. The State Council issued an opinion in April to expand capacity and improve quality. Service trade surplus narrowed by about 20%.
